本文是基於ASP.NET Identity v2的實施的“角色-權限”實驗小結,不對基礎知識進行介紹,讀者需理解面向對象、接口編程、AOP、MVC,掌握ASP.NET MVC、JavaScript和EF。 環境:VS2013 update4,EF6,ASP.NET MVC 5,bootstrap ...
. 自定義屬性 參考:ASP.NET Identity . : Customizing Users and Roles 以擴展ApplicationUser為例。 . . 新增Password屬性 修改IdentityModel.cs,ApplicationUser繼承自IdentityUser,只需為它增加Password屬性,用來保存密碼明文。 public class Applicatio ...
2015-02-28 00:22 0 2649 推薦指數:
本文是基於ASP.NET Identity v2的實施的“角色-權限”實驗小結,不對基礎知識進行介紹,讀者需理解面向對象、接口編程、AOP、MVC,掌握ASP.NET MVC、JavaScript和EF。 環境:VS2013 update4,EF6,ASP.NET MVC 5,bootstrap ...
當我們使用ASP.NET 4.5創建模板項目時,會發現模板只提供了ApplicationUserManager用於用戶的登錄注冊、修改、設置等,而沒有提供與用戶角色相關的代碼,對此就需要我們自己手動的添加。 第一步:在IdentityConfig.cs文件里面添加一個 ...
using Microsoft.AspNet.Identity; ...
RightControl 介紹 .NET 通用后台角色權限管理系統,已完成。項目地址:http://rightcontrol.baocaige.top/Admin/Login 碼雲地址:https://gitee.com/Liu_Cabbage/RightControl 軟件架構 通用三層 ...
修改用戶控制器AccountController,增加角色管理器。 public class AccountController : Controller { public AccountController() { } public AccountController ...
注:本文系作者原創,但可隨意轉載。 最近做一個Web平台系統,系統包含3個角色,“管理員, 企業用戶, 評審專家”, 分別有不同的功能。一直以來都是使用微軟封裝好的Microsoft.AspNet.Identity.dll程序集來進行身份驗證和角色控制。 在MVC項目中,生成項目 ...
ASP.NET Identity 身份驗證和基於角色的授權 閱讀目錄 探索身份驗證與授權 使用ASP.NET Identity 身份驗證 使用角色進行授權 初始化數據,Seeding 數據庫 小結 在前一篇文章中,我介紹了ASP.NET ...
asp.net Identity自帶有角色功能,但默認的模板並沒有啟用。啟用Role的步驟如下:定義role模型--配置角色管理器---配置初始化器---修改數據庫上下對象---在應用程序啟動文件中配置角色請求 1、定義模型: 在IdentityModel.cs //定義程序的角色模型,繼承 ...